Summary of Bill HR 9525

The bill titled "To amend title 18, United States Code, to limit the ability to assess a fee for health care services for prisoners, and for other purposes," designated as H.R. 9525 in the 119th Congress, was introduced on June 29, 2026. The bill aims to restrict the imposition of fees for health care services for prisoners and likely includes provisions related to modifying the current system of health care cost assessments within the prison system. Current Status of Bill HR 9525

Bill HR 9525 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since June 29, 2026. Bill HR 9525 was introduced during Congress 119 and was introduced to the House on June 29, 2026.  Bill HR 9525's most recent activity was Referred to the House Committee on the Judiciary. as of June 29, 2026
